Output 838880c71b9bfc78c4bf36d02b3ad98b69c336981eec4a3d0b73ee7ad0f7139c:0

value
8869885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23162c8c881ef8f75103e5ff4f4cbaa07c60a0cc OP_EQUAL
address
34tY8wDvUVtdCFMxZ99w4bKoxc2PCJY2oq
transaction
838880c71b9bfc78c4bf36d02b3ad98b69c336981eec4a3d0b73ee7ad0f7139c
confirmations
407744
spent
true